Some random Guardian BTS trivia!

For the "Backstory" square on my Guardian Bingo card, a small collection of Guardian lore from the early days of filming. (I'm not breaking any new ground here, just assembling some stuff from here and there!)




First of all! Zhu Yilong was one of the winners at the 13th TV Drama South Awarding Ceremony in January of 2017. According to Wikipedia, he won the Best Supporting Actor award for his role in The Shaw Eleven Lang. The Weibo tag for the event has quite a bit of Long-ge content if you scroll. In April of 2017, filming for Guardian started. Zhu Yilong was 29, and Bai Yu was 27. Pictures have surfaced that presumably show early concepts of the outfits (and hair and make-up). Zhu Yilong had just finished filming As Flowers Fade and Fly Across The Sky when he joined the Guardian cast. He accepted the role to help out a friend when the original Shen Wei actor had to drop out. The actor was Ren Yankai, and I think we're all thanking the heavens for those scheduling conflicts (no offense). 😄

According to The Primer, Bai Yu spent 2016 and early 2017 filming The Fated General, Zhao Ge, and The Founding of an Army. Only the last one has actually been released; it aired in 2017. At this point, The Fated General might just never be freed from censorship jail. (Bai Yu's role in Zhao Ge seems rather small, but looking at the main cast, it's toast now anyway.)

Zhu Yilong had learned about sleeve garters when he filmed Eternal Wave (where he played Cen Zimo), and thought they'd work well for Shen Wei. It's also accepted lore that he contributed some of his own clothes to Shen Wei's wardrobe, although I can't remember seeing a definite source on this.

Both of them read the novel to prepare for their roles, which is kind of its own amazing thought. Bai Yu's reaction to the novel was, "Can you even film this? Can this be aired?!" (MOOD.) He accepted the role when he was told it was turned into a bromance for the drama. (And we know how that turned out.)

Apparently, the "Shen Wei applies ointment to Zhao Yunlan's arm" was the very first scene they shot together. There's a brief behind-the-scenes video of the early days, and a longer video collecting moments from the start of filming to the day they wrapped. Many iconic BTS clips in there!
